TEMPO.CO, Jakarta - The global crude palm oil (CPO) market is waking up, affecting directly the fresh fruit bunch (FFB) price from the first period of September 2023.
According to Rudi Arpian, Analyst of the Facilities and Infrastructure at the Plantation Office of South Sumatra, the office along with several regional stakeholders priced FFB for 10-20 planting years at Rp2,362.19.
"Meaning, there is an increase compared to FFB from the second period of August 2023," he said on Tuesday.
Meanwhile, hot weather experienced by half of the world has proven beneficial for local and national palm oil farmers. The increase in global CPO prices could be attributed to the extreme weather experienced by many CPO producer countries. According to Rudi, the extreme weather caused CPO production to lower in number, including sunflower oil and soybean.
Additionally, the increase in demand directly affects plasma farmers and self-subsistent farmers. "In relation to the hot weather, palm oil companies and palm oil farmers are urged to remain vigilant to the threat of wildfires," Rudi added.
The FFB prices in South Sumatra will be implemented for purchases from September 1 until 15, 2023. The detail is as follows:
- 3 years from plantation priced at Rp2,065.15 per kilogram;
- 4 years from plantation priced at Rp2,116.94;
- 5 years from plantation priced at Rp2,164.50;
- 6 years from plantation priced at Rp2,206.87;
- 7 years from plantation priced at Rp2,244.93;
- 8 years from plantation priced at Rp2,279.67;
- 9 years from plantation priced at Rp2,309.11;
- 10-20 years from plantation priced at Rp2,362.19;
- 21 years from plantation priced at Rp2,331.94;
- 22 years from plantation priced at Rp2,305.82;
- 23 years from plantation priced at Rp2,274.84;
- 24 years from plantation priced at Rp2,239.47;
- and 25 years from plantation priced at Rp2,163.02.
